Tablet computers are completely new to me. I'm thinking of buying buying the Zenithink C91 10.2 inch model. My make or brake question is, how decent is the range of the wireless? How does it stack up compared to other tablet brands? Is it comparable to that of a typical laptop?

I think individual examples may display differing results, but I have not been impressed by the Wifi reception of my ZT-282 C71. Not sure if the C91 is different hardware, but it's about the only shortcoming I have noticed about it. If I get further than about 20' and a wall away from the router, the signal reception drops way down. My HP laptop gets the router signal just fine, as does the Acer desktop I am using for an HTPC, and the PS3. There are other reports of weak reception in the forums that seem to single out the antenna as the culprit. I've ordered a repeater myself to boost my router network range. Otherwise, I'm pretty happy with the ZT-Pad performance.
